J&K: 5 Terrorists Killed By Security Forces In Shopian, 106 Eliminated Since January

Five unidentified militants have been killed in the operation, and dead bodies have been recovered.

New Delhi:  Two more militants have been killed in a gunfight with a joint team of Police, CRPF and Army in Sugoo Hendhama area of Shopian on Wednesday, taking the militant death toll to five in the ‘ongoing operation’ and 14 in last less than three days in the southern Kashmir district on Wednesday. Also Read| Ladakh Standoff: India, China Pull Back Armies At 3 Disputed Locations; Military Talks To Continue "Yes, five unidentified militants have been killed in the operation, and dead bodies have been recovered. We have also recovered arms and ammunitions," IG Kashmir Vijay Kumar confirmed This is the third major encounter in the district in less than a week. So far 20 terrorists have been killed in the month of June, the identity of the slain militants is yet to be ascertained. It is pertinent to mention that a total of 14 terrorists have been killed all alone in the Shopian district since 7th June including two commanders. While the total number of terrorists killed since January 2020 is 106 now, of which 55 have been killed since March. Meanwhile, Mobile Internet has been suspended in the Shopian district for precautionary measures. Earlier, a joint team of Police, Army's 44RR, and CRPF launched a cordon-and-search-operation in Sugoo Hendhama. As the joint team approached the suspected spot, the hiding terrorists fired upon them. The fire was retaliated by the joint team, triggering off an encounter.
